repo.or.cz
/
wine
/
wine-gecko.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Only initialize unused components of varyings that are read.
2009-06-17
Henri Verb
e
et
w
ine
d
3d: Only in
i
tial
i
ze unused com
p
onents of varyings
.
.
.
commit
|
commitdiff
|
tree
2009-06-17
Henri Verbeet
wined3d: Fal
l
back
to
backbu
f
fe
r
o
f
f
s
c
r
een rendering
.
.
.
commit
|
commitdiff
|
tree
2009-06-17
He
n
ri Verbeet
wined3d
:
Fix a typo
.
commit
|
commitdiff
|
tree
2009-06-16
H
enri Verbeet
win
e
d3
d
:
A
d
d format convers
i
ons fo
r
s
o
m
e dept
h
stenc
i
l
.
.
.
commit
|
commitdiff
|
tree
2009-06-16
Henri Verbeet
d3d8: Add t
e
sts for
deleting inva
l
id shader handles
.
commit
|
commitdiff
|
tree
2009-06-16
Henri V
e
rbe
e
t
d
3d8:
D
eleting
an invalid pixel shader handl
e
shou
l
d
.
.
.
commit
|
commitdiff
|
tree
2009-06-16
Henri Verbeet
d3d8: Do some m
o
r
e veri
f
i
cation
on
h
andles
.
commit
|
commitdiff
|
tree
2009-06-16
Henri
V
er
b
eet
s
hdoc
v
w
:
Add SHDOCVW_Lo
c
k
Modul
e
()/SHDOCVW_UnlockModule
.
.
.
commit
|
commitdiff
|
tree
2009-06-16
H
e
nri Verbeet
s
h
docvw: Take the riid par
a
meter to TaskbarList_Create
.
.
.
commit
|
commitdiff
|
tree
2009-06-15
Henri Ve
r
beet
wined
3
d
:
Get
r
id of the pointers
i
n WINED3DSU
R
FACE
_
D
E
SC
.
commit
|
commitdiff
|
tree
2009-06-15
Henr
i
Verbeet
w
i
ned3d: Int
r
oduce surface_calculate_size()
.
commit
|
commitdiff
|
tree
2009-06-15
Henri
V
erbee
t
wine
d
3d: Introduce sur
f
ace_ini
t
(
)
to hand
l
e most
o
f
.
.
.
commit
|
commitdiff
|
tree
2009-06-15
Henri Verbeet
wined
3
d:
I
n
tro
d
uce su
r
face_gdi_cle
a
nup()
.
commit
|
commitdiff
|
tree
2009-06-15
Henri Verbeet
wined3d: Introd
u
ce surface_cleanup(
)
.
commit
|
commitdiff
|
tree
2009-06-12
Hen
r
i
Verbee
t
wine
d
3d: A
v
oid checki
n
g
depth/stencil and compre
s
sed
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Hen
r
i V
e
r
beet
wined3d: Respe
c
t the "srgb" parameter to IWineD3DSurfac
e
Impl
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Henri Verbeet
wined3d: Remove the useless "resource_type"
p
arameter
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
H
e
nri Verbeet
wined3d: Use WINED3DFMT_FLAG
_
CO
M
P
RESSED instead of
.
.
.
commit
|
commitdiff
|
tree
2009-06-12
Henri V
e
rbeet
wined3d: Use the compressed format i
n
f
o in IWi
n
e
D3DBaseSurfa
.
.
.
commit
|
commitdiff
|
tree
2009-06-11
H
e
nri Verbeet
wined3d: Use the
f
orm
a
t info t
o
ca
l
culat
e
co
m
p
r
es
s
ed
.
.
.
commit
|
commitdiff
|
tree
2009-06-11
Henr
i
V
erbeet
wined3d: Us
e
the format inf
o
to calculate compress
e
d
.
.
.
commit
|
commitdiff
|
tree
2009-06-11
He
n
ri
V
erbeet
wined3d:
Use the format info t
o
c
alcula
t
e compressed
.
.
.
commit
|
commitdiff
|
tree
2009-06-11
H
e
nri Verb
e
e
t
wined3d:
Improve some T
R
A
C
Es in ini
t
_format_fbo_
c
ompat_info(
)
.
commit
|
commitdiff
|
tree
2009-06-11
Henri
V
e
rbeet
wined3d
:
R
e
move som
e
red
u
ndant s
3
t
c extensio
n
che
c
ks
.
commit
|
commitdiff
|
tree
2009-06-10
Henri Verb
e
et
w
ine
d
3
d
: Use the format info for doi
n
g compr
e
s
sed surface
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Hen
r
i Verbeet
wined3d
:
Stor
e
c
ompression in
f
ormation about compr
e
ssed
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Henr
i
Verbee
t
wined3d:
R
ou
n
d rows u
p
to
w
h
ole
b
locks for compre
s
sed
.
.
.
commit
|
commitdiff
|
tree
2009-06-10
Henri Verbeet
w
ined3d:
Check the correct extension
s
in
d
3dfmt
_
get_co
n
v()
.
commit
|
commitdiff
|
tree
2009-06-10
Hen
r
i
V
erbeet
wined3d: Set ex
p
licitl
y
s
i
z
ed in
t
ernal formats fo
r
.
.
.
commit
|
commitdiff
|
tree
2009-06-09
Hen
r
i Verbeet
wined3d: Add some FIXMEs
about blitti
n
g with uns
u
pported
.
.
.
commit
|
commitdiff
|
tree
2009-06-09
Henri Verbeet
wined
3
d:
Get rid of the silly pointers
in
W
I
N
ED3DVOLUME_
D
E
SC
.
commit
|
commitdiff
|
tree
2009-06-09
H
e
nri Verbeet
w
i
ned3d: Don'
t
modify the inter
n
al format
i
n d3dfm
t
_get_conv()
.
commit
|
commitdiff
|
tree
2009-06-09
He
n
ri
V
erbeet
wined3d: Simplify
s
ome code
i
n set_glsl_shad
e
r_program()
.
commit
|
commitdiff
|
tree
2009-06-09
Henri Verbeet
win
e
d3d: Av
o
id
compar
i
n
g
s
hader
c
ompi
l
e ar
g
s if the
.
.
.
commit
|
commitdiff
|
tree
2009-06-08
Henri Verbeet
w
ined3d: Set FBO ste
n
cil att
a
c
h
ments
f
or
r
e
le
v
ant depth
.
.
.
commit
|
commitdiff
|
tree
2009-06-08
Henr
i
V
er
b
ee
t
wined3d: Use conte
x
t_
a
ttach_depth
_
st
e
nci
l
_f
b
o(
)
to
.
.
.
commit
|
commitdiff
|
tree
2009-06-08
H
e
nri Ver
b
e
e
t
win
e
d3d
:
U
s
e GL_
D
EPTH32F_STENCIL8 for WI
N
ED3DF
M
T_D24FS8
.
commit
|
commitdiff
|
tree
2009-06-08
Henri Ve
r
b
e
et
wined3d: Use GL_DEPTH_CO
M
PON
E
NT32F for WINED3DFMT
_
D32F_L
O
C
KAB
L
E
.
commit
|
commitdiff
|
tree
2009-06-08
Henr
i
Verbeet
wined3d: Add suppor
t
for the AR
B
_depth_
b
uffer_floa
t
.
.
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Verbeet
wined3d: Use GL_DE
P
TH24
_
STENCIL8_EX
T
for depth stencil
.
.
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Verbeet
wined3d: Add supp
o
r
t
for EXT_packed_dep
t
h_stencil
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Verbeet
wined3d: U
s
e FBOs for offscreen rendering by
default
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Verbeet
w
i
ned3d: Only use st
r
etch_
r
ect_fbo(
)
o
n s
u
rfaces that
.
.
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Ver
b
eet
wined
3
d
: Check FBO c
o
m
p
atibility o
n
all form
a
ts with
.
.
.
commit
|
commitdiff
|
tree
2009-06-05
He
n
ri Verb
e
et
wine
d
3d: Se
t
texture filtering to NEAREST
i
n check_f
b
o_compat()
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Verbeet
wined3d:
Add extension
de
t
ecti
o
n to
the GL format template
.
.
.
commit
|
commitdiff
|
tree
2009-06-05
Henri
V
e
rb
e
et
wined3d
:
A
d
d extens
i
on detecti
o
n for ARB_de
p
th_t
e
xtu
r
e
.
commit
|
commitdiff
|
tree
2009-06-05
H
e
n
ri
V
erbee
t
wined3d: Don't use the
v
e
r
t
e
x
/p
i
xel shader when we
.
.
.
commit
|
commitdiff
|
tree
2009-06-05
Henri Verbeet
wi
n
ed3d: Check
t
he
resu
l
t
f
r
om
w
ine_rb_get() b
e
fore
.
.
.
commit
|
commitdiff
|
tree
2009-06-04
Henri Verbeet
w
ined3d: Add a prop
e
r enum va
l
u
e
for
"
n
o
ext
e
ns
i
on"
.
commit
|
commitdiff
|
tree
2009-06-04
Henri Verbeet
wined3d: Check
F
BO compatibility after the fixups
a
re
.
.
.
commit
|
commitdiff
|
tree
2009-06-04
Henri
V
er
b
e
e
t
wined3d:
Remove WINED3DFMT_R16G16B16A16_SNO
R
M from
.
.
.
commit
|
commitdiff
|
tree
2009-06-04
H
e
n
ri Verbeet
wined3d: Remove entri
e
s without
a
n internal format
.
.
.
commit
|
commitdiff
|
tree
2009-06-04
Henri Verbeet
wi
n
e
d
3d: F
r
e
e
priv->
s
tack in shader_glsl_free()
.
commit
|
commitdiff
|
tree
2009-06-03
Henri Verb
e
et
wined3d: Repla
c
e the wined3d hash table with the
gene
r
ic
.
.
.
commit
|
commitdiff
|
tree
2009-06-03
Henri Ve
r
beet
include:
Add a generic
r
ed-black tree
.
commit
|
commitdiff
|
tree
2009-06-03
H
e
nri Verbeet
wine
d
3d
:
Introduce vol
u
mete
x
ture_init() to handl
e
most
.
.
.
commit
|
commitdiff
|
tree
2009-06-03
H
enri Ver
b
e
e
t
wine
d
3d: Intro
d
uce volumetexture_
c
leanup()
.
commit
|
commitdiff
|
tree
2009-06-03
Henri V
e
rb
e
et
wined3d:
Intr
o
duc
e
cubetextu
r
e_
i
nit(
)
to handle most
.
.
.
commit
|
commitdiff
|
tree
2009-06-03
H
enri Verb
e
e
t
win
e
d3d: Introduc
e
cubetexture_clea
n
up(
)
.
commit
|
commitdiff
|
tree
2009-06-03
Henri Verbe
e
t
wined3
d
: Introduce
t
exture_
i
nit()
t
o handle mos
t
o
f
.
.
.
commit
|
commitdiff
|
tree
2009-06-02
Henri Verbeet
wined3d: Create
a
texture_cleanup()
fu
n
ction
.
commit
|
commitdiff
|
tree
2009-06-02
Henri Ve
r
beet
wine
d
3d
:
Call resource_in
i
t() from basetex
t
u
r
e_init()
.
commit
|
commitdiff
|
tree
2009-06-02
Hen
r
i Verbeet
w
i
ned3d:
Partially revert 7433eb
7
6
b
5f05ae54702fe9e57ba315407
.
.
.
commit
|
commitdiff
|
tree
2009-05-29
Henri Ver
b
eet
wined3d:
U
se the
p
roper OUT swizzle in handle_ps
3
_input()
.
commit
|
commitdiff
|
tree
2009-05-29
Henri Ver
b
eet
d3d9: Ha
v
ing a NULL
r
e
nde
r
target isn't a failu
r
e
.
commit
|
commitdiff
|
tree
2009-05-29
Henri Verbeet
w
ine
d
3d:
A
dd de
v
ic
e
resou
r
ces from res
o
u
r
ce
_
in
i
t
()
.
commit
|
commitdiff
|
tree
2009-05-29
H
en
r
i
Ve
r
beet
wined3d: R
e
move ResourceRele
a
sed() from the public
.
.
.
commit
|
commitdiff
|
tree
2009-05-29
Henri
V
er
b
eet
win
e
d
3
d:
A
dd missing
A
ctivateContext calls
t
o shader_destroy
.
.
.
commit
|
commitdiff
|
tree
2009-05-28
Hen
r
i V
e
rbeet
wined3d: Remove the
"declara
t
ion" pa
r
ameter to IWineD3
D
D
e
vic
.
.
.
commit
|
commitdiff
|
tree
2009-05-28
Henri
Verbeet
d3d10core:
D
on't complain as
m
uch
ab
o
ut setti
n
g a NULL
.
.
.
commit
|
commitdiff
|
tree
2009-05-28
He
n
ri Verbeet
d3d10core: Implement ID3
D
10Device
:
:VSSetS
h
ader()
.
commit
|
commitdiff
|
tree
2009-05-28
H
e
nri
Ver
b
e
e
t
w
i
ne
d
3d: M
a
tch
the d3
d
1
0
name for WINE
D
3DDECL
U
SAGE_POSI
T
IO
N
.
commit
|
commitdiff
|
tree
2009-05-28
Henri Verbe
e
t
wined3d: Use the ou
t
put
signat
u
re to setup SM4
v
ertex
.
.
.
commit
|
commitdiff
|
tree
2009-05-27
Henri
V
e
r
b
e
e
t
wined
3
d:
U
s
e
strings fo
r
shade
r
input/output seman
t
ics
.
commit
|
commitdiff
|
tree
2009-05-27
H
e
nri Verbeet
wined
3
d
:
U
se
a
separate str
u
ctu
r
e for v
e
r
t
ex shader
.
.
.
commit
|
commitdiff
|
tree
2009-05-27
Henri V
e
rbe
e
t
wined
3
d: M
a
k
e
"
packed
_
out
p
ut" a bitmap
.
commit
|
commitdiff
|
tree
2009-05-27
H
enr
i
Verbeet
wined
3
d
: Us
e
the "i
n
put_registers" b
i
tmap for v
e
rtex
.
.
.
commit
|
commitdiff
|
tree
2009-05-27
He
n
ri Ve
r
beet
wine
d
3d:
Make "packed_input" a
bitmap
.
commit
|
commitdiff
|
tree
2009-05-26
Henri Verbeet
wi
n
ed3d:
U
s
e SM3 shade
r
limits for SM
4
.
commit
|
commitdiff
|
tree
2009-05-26
He
n
r
i
Verb
e
et
d3d10core
:
Implement
ID3D10Device
:
:C
r
eateVert
e
xShader()
.
commit
|
commitdiff
|
tree
2009-05-26
H
enri Verbeet
wined3
d
: Add
the output signature to
IWineD3DDevice_CreateVe
.
.
.
commit
|
commitdiff
|
tree
2009-05-26
Henr
i
Verbeet
wined3d: S
p
lit the info log into separ
a
t
e
l
i
nes
.
commit
|
commitdiff
|
tree
2009-05-26
H
e
nri Verb
e
e
t
wi
n
ed3d:
P
as
s
a pr
o
per format desc t
o
reso
u
rce
_
init
.
.
.
commit
|
commitdiff
|
tree
2009-05-25
H
e
n
r
i
V
erbeet
wined3d
:
Fix debug
_
d
3
d
usage
q
u
ery() to han
d
l
e
co
m
bina
t
i
o
ns
.
.
.
commit
|
commitdiff
|
tree
2009-05-25
Henri Verbee
t
w
i
n
ed3d: Fix de
b
ug_d3dusage
(
) to handle co
m
bina
t
ion
s
.
.
.
commit
|
commitdiff
|
tree
2009-05-25
Henr
i
Verbeet
w
i
ne
d
3d: Remove
some apparently l
e
ftove
r
debug code
.
commit
|
commitdiff
|
tree
2009-05-25
Hen
r
i Verbeet
w
ined3d: Remove some
unnecessary fo
r
ward declara
t
ions
.
commit
|
commitdiff
|
tree
2009-05-25
He
n
r
i
Verbeet
s
e
cur
3
2: Initialize cbBuf
f
er to 0 for NULL bu
f
f
e
rs
.
commit
|
commitdiff
|
tree
2009-05-15
He
n
ri Ve
r
beet
wined3
d
: Remove some unused defines
.
commit
|
commitdiff
|
tree
2009-05-15
Henri Verbeet
wi
n
e
d
3d: Document function
s
that
d
epend on the caller
.
.
.
commit
|
commitdiff
|
tree
2009-05-15
Henri Verbeet
wined3d: Add
mi
s
sing GL
lo
c
king to check_fbo_
c
ompat
(
)
.
commit
|
commitdiff
|
tree
2009-05-15
Henri Verbeet
win
e
d3d:
Add
miss
i
ng
GL locking to
f
fp_blit
_
se
t
() a
n
d
.
.
.
commit
|
commitdiff
|
tree
2009-05-15
H
e
n
ri
Verbe
e
t
wined3d: Add miss
i
n
g G
L
loc
k
ing to d3dfmt_
p
8_uplo
a
d_
p
a
lette()
.
commit
|
commitdiff
|
tree
2009-05-14
He
n
r
i
Verbee
t
wined3d: Add mi
s
sing
GL locking to test_pbo
_
f
u
n
ctionality()
.
commit
|
commitdiff
|
tree
2009-05-14
He
n
ri Verb
e
et
wined3d: Add mi
s
sing GL locki
n
g
to
I
WineD3DDeviceImpl_
U
nini
t
.
.
.
commit
|
commitdiff
|
tree
2009-05-14
H
e
nri
V
erbeet
wined3
d
:
Add missing GL
l
o
c
king
to set_blit_dimens
i
on
.
.
.
commit
|
commitdiff
|
tree
2009-05-14
Henri
V
erbee
t
wine
d
3d: Add
mi
s
sing GL locking to
ca
l
ls to FBO fu
n
ctions
.
commit
|
commitdiff
|
tree
2009-05-14
Henri Verbeet
wined3d: Add missing
G
L locking t
o
del
e
te_gls
l
_progr
a
m_entry
.
.
.
commit
|
commitdiff
|
tree
2009-05-13
H
enri Verb
e
e
t
w
i
ned3d:
A
dd missing
GL locking to shader_
b
a
c
kend_t
.
.
.
commit
|
commitdiff
|
tree
next